The Very Frustrated Monster is a relatable, humorous picture book that helps children “see” and understand frustration and anger in an age‑appropriate and reassuring way. Through the story of Twitch, readers explore what it feels like when things don’t go as planned and how those big emotions can quickly take over.

Twitch tries very hard to do everything right, but when something goes wrong, frustration bubbles over. If you’ve ever had a day where everything seems to go wrong, Twitch’s story will feel instantly familiar. With warmth and humour, this book gently puts life’s everyday setbacks into perspective, helping children recognise that frustration is a normal part of learning and growing. The Very Frustrated Monster is a supportive and engaging picture book that helps children make sense of frustration encouraging empathy, perspective and positive emotional growth through storytelling and shared discussion.

Key Educational & Emotional Benefits

  • Supports Social & Emotional Learning (SEL): The story helps children identify and name feelings of frustration and anger, supporting emotional literacy and self‑awareness.
  • Builds Understanding of Big Emotions: By externalising frustration through Twitch’s experiences, children gain insight into what frustration looks like, feels like and why it happens.
  • Encourages Discussion & Emotional Expression: The story naturally invites conversation, reflection and sharing, helping children talk about times they felt frustrated and how they responded.
  • Engaging Storytelling & Humour: The light‑hearted narrative and expressive illustrations keep children engaged while delivering meaningful emotional messages in a non‑threatening way.
  • Promotes Perspective & Emotional Regulation: By seeing how Twitch navigates his emotions, children are reassured that setbacks are part of life and emotions can be managed with support and understanding.
